High 1019 hPa centered on West Channel moving at 8 knots to the North-North-West to be centered on the South-West of England.Low 1008 hPa centered at 130 nautical miles in the South-West of Fastnet Rock (South-West Ireland) moving at 10 knots to the North-North-West and dropping to 1005 hPa to be centered at 100 nautical miles in the West-South-West of Belmullet (North-West Ireland).
For Plage de la pointe de Bihit :
No gale warning.
We are 90% sure of the situation, because the high pressure system could move in more quickly than forecast.
Clear skies. In the evening, skies gradually hazing over.
No precipitation. W force 3 in the middle of the day turning N force 2 in the evening. Smooth to slight sea. Low, fairly long swell from WNW. Poor visibility becoming good in the evening.
